Background technology
ADS_B tester is by sending simulation ADS_B association message and interference signal, and to verify, the function of test ADS_B receiving equipment and performance, also can be the maintenance of ADS_B receiving equipment and the use of examination simultaneously.This tester supports that user inputs the related content of ADS_B information (DF17/18) message, the A/C pattern message supporting user to input transmission rate and content can to arrange, the interference signal type such as burst pulse, continuous wave that transmission rate and pulse duration can be arranged.ADS_B tester can carry out automated closed-loop test and semi-automatic test.

Embodiment
ADS_B tester is in strict accordance with the requirement of ICAOANNEX10, RTCADO-260, RTCADO-260A/B, EUROCONTROLASTERIXCategory021 related specifications, and in conjunction with ADS_B receiving equipment testing requirement, airborne answering machine or ADS_BOUT equipment transmitting ADS_B signal (DF17/18), A/C signal and interference signal can be simulated in batches, realize testing the receptivity of ADS_B receiving equipment.ADS_B tester supports that user oneself arranges message interval time, tranmitting frequency, and transmitted power level supports Ethernet and serial communication.
As shown in Figure 1, ADS_B tester comprises main frame, aobvious control terminal, is connected between main frame with aobvious control terminal by network interface or serial ports.Tested to as if ADS_B receiving equipment, send test massage to equipment under test by antenna or direct-connected radio frequency cable.
If accompanying drawing 2 is with shown in accompanying drawing 3, tester main frame is made up of frequency synthesizer, programmable attenuator, signal-processing board, power module.
ADS_B tester of the present invention can test ADS_B receiving equipment signal handling capacity, project broken down as follows:
● target disposal ability (process capacity)
● anti-interference rejection ability
● packet parsing correctness
● process time delay
ADS_B tester by the message simulation such as position, speed, the state actual complex signal scene of the multiple target of Mass production, and tests process capacity and the data throughput capabilities of ADS_B receiving equipment with this.ADS_B tester realizes the interference environments such as simulating multi-path, A/C, random pulses by arranging two passages transmission unlike signal mixing outputs, and tests the anti-interference rejection ability of ADS_B receiving equipment with this.The correctness of packet parsing can be judged by the decoded result contrasting ADS_B tester coded data and tested ADS_B receiving equipment.By closed loop test mode, contrast sends and time of reception can realize the process time delay testing ADS_B receiving equipment.Test connection diagram as shown in Figure 4.
